Where does Skymap Ransomware come from?

As far as we managed to find out, Skymap Ransomware is part of the STOP Ransomware family, and so certain distribution and behavioral patterns can be applied across different infections from the same group. Therefore, we can surely say that Skymap Ransomware is an annoying infection, and it won’t step down.

We believe that Skymap Ransomware comes via spam email attachments, and users download and install this infection willingly. Of course, they are not aware of that, because, who would ever want to install this program willingly? The problem is that spam emails that distribute Skymap Ransomware are very sophisticated. They are seldom filtered into the Junk folder, and they also look like official notifications from reputable sources. As a result, a lot of users get confused and open such files without any second thought.

You could avoid Skymap Ransomware if you were to delete messages from unknown senders immediately. Also, you could make use of a reliable antispyware tool to scan the attached file before opening it. If the scanner says that the file is dangerous, you should delete it no questions asked.

What does Skymap Ransomware do?

Perhaps we do not really need to go through the basic ransomware behavioral patterns. If it is your first time getting infected with that kind of program, you should definitely have in mind that Skymap Ransomware scans your system looking for the types of files it can encrypt. Usually, ransomware programs affect files in the %USERPROFILE% directory, thus encrypting most of the personal files.

These programs also tend to overlook system files because they need your computer to function properly if they intend to collect the ransom fee. Hence, it is very likely that programs files and the Windows system files will remain intact after the encryption. On the other hand, the affected files will receive the “.skymap” extension to their names, and it is going to be really easy to tell which files were affected by the encryption.

Aside from the extension, Skymap Ransomware will also drop a ransom note in every single folder with the encrypted files. The ransom note is a TXT format file with the _readme.txt filename. If you open the file, here’s what you are going to find there:

As you can see, Skymap Ransomware is very straightforward when it comes to demanding money. Although these criminals are the ones who have the decryption key, let’s not forget that you can always restore your files from a file backup. If you have copies of your files saved on an external hard drive, you do not need to worry about anything. Simply delete the encrypted files, remove Skymap Ransomware, and transfer the healthy copies into your computer.

Manual Skymap Ransomware

  1. Delete unfamiliar files from Desktop.
  2. Go to the Downloads folder and remove the most recently downloaded files.
  3. Press Win+R and type regedit. Click OK.
  4. Go to H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Run.
  5. On the right side, right-click and delete the SysHelper value.
  6. Exist Registry Editor and press Win+R. Enter %UserProfile%. Click OK.
  7. Go to Local Settings\Application Data.
  8. Delete the random name folder that has this name format: 0cc97d97-6cc7-4817-b300-eb6e298327c6.
  9. Repeat the same action with the %LocalAppData% directory (via Win+R).
  10. Press Win+R again and type %WinDir%. Click OK.
  11. Go to System32\Tasks.
